JULIUS’S POV

I froze. “A note?”

She nodded, still crying. “Yes. It had your handwriting and your scent. I swear, Julius, I thought you wanted this.”

My mind went blank for a moment. Then it hit me like a punch to the gut. Someone had set us up. Someone wanted Angela and my mother to catch us together.

But who would do something like that? And why tonight, of all nights?

As Kimberly sat there sobbing quietly, I could only stare at the floor, my hands clenched into fists. Whoever did this, whoever destroyed everything between Angela and me, was going to regret it.

I threw on the first shirt I could grab, barely buttoning it as I ran out of the room. My heart was pounding in my chest, not just from panic but from sheer desperation. I couldn’t let her walk away like that, not again. Not like this.

I sprinted down the hallway, ignoring the curious stares from a few servants I passed. The moment I reached the end of the corridor, I heard faint music and laughter echoing from the party hall.
